PURPOSE OF POSITION

Under general direction of the Chief of Psychiatry, provides executive administrative leadership and operational management of behavioral health programs including Inpatient, Outpatient, Comprehensive Psychiatric Emergency Program (CPEP) services, as well as associated Behavioral Health programs. The Administrator ensures compliance with City, State and Federal regulations; manages the department's fiscal and strategic infrastructure in alignment with clinical leadership; and serves as the senior administrative liaison to the NYS Office of Mental Health (OMH), NYS Office of Addiction Services and Supports (OASAS), Department of Health and Mental Hygiene (DOHMH) and the System’s Office of Behavioral Health.

Duties & Responsibilities

  • Directs the administrative and operational functions of behavioral health services, including Inpatient unit, Outpatient services, CPEP, Assertive Community Treatment (ACT), Consultation Liaison, Critical Time Intervention, and other programs within the Department of Behavioral Health.
  • Partners with the Chief and executive leadership in strategic planning, resource allocation, and the development of departmental goals aligned with the delivery of cost-effective services and a positive patient experience.
  • Oversees the Department of Behavioral Health budget, including preparing budget requests, monitoring revenue and expenditures, management of grants, and ensuring compliance with budgetary guidelines.
  • Serves as the senior liaison and ensures health care setting compliance with all licensing and regulatory requirements, including NYS Office of Mental Health (OMH), NYC Department of Health Mental Health (DOHMH), NYS Office of Addiction Services and Supports (OASAS), The Joint Commission (TJC), Center for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S), and all other applicable regulatory and accrediting bodies.
  • Represents the Department of Behavioral Health at executive-level health care setting and System-wide committees, including Environment of Care (EOC), Emergency Management, Patient Experience, and other related committees.
  • Serves as the health care setting’s senior administrative representative to the System’s Office of Behavioral Health.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Master’s degree from an accredited college or university in Hospital or Health Care Administration, Public Health or a related discipline and five (5) years of high-level responsible experience in Hospital, Business, or Public Administration or a Health Care Administrator in a position of direct responsibility for operations of a major part or all of a health care setting, including substantial exposure in meeting community health needs; or
  • Bachelor’s degree from an accredited college or university in disciplines, as listed in “1” above, or a related discipline; and six (6) years of high-level experience in areas as described in “1” above.
